Executive Board of the Armenia Pan-Armenian Foundation Prepares Detailed Report on Its Activities and Expenditures

The fundraising initiative "We Are Our Borders" by the Armenia Pan-Armenian Foundation was launched with a unified decision on September 27 of this year, from the very first moments of the war. The call to participate in the fundraising was made by the President of the Republic of Armenia, Chairman of the Foundation’s Board of Trustees Armen Sarkissian, members of the Board of Trustees, including the President of Artsakh, the Catholicos of All Armenians, the Catholicos of the Great House of Cilicia, and others. Hundreds of thousands of compatriots from both the Diaspora and Armenia took part in the nationwide fundraising campaign. The role of all the organizations, parties, civil society organizations from the Diaspora involved in the fundraising process, as well as the local organizations of the Foundation operating in various countries, is also invaluable. From the very first day, the Foundation and its international network have provided continuous large-scale assistance to Artsakh by working directly with the government of the Republic of Artsakh, the representation of Artsakh in Armenia, the Ministry of Health of the Republic of Armenia, and other departments. This includes diesel generators, ambulances, medical equipment and first aid supplies, essential household items, wood-burning stoves, electric heaters, portable gas stoves, portable charging stations, beds, and a variety of other substantial assistance aimed at alleviating the humanitarian crisis during the war. At the same time, more than one hundred tons of humanitarian aid have been delivered to the homeland in the form of cargo through the network of the Armenia Pan-Armenian Foundation.

In light of the situation that arose after September 27 of this year, the need arose to maximally consolidate resources formed in the Republic of Armenia for the centralized implementation of urgent procurements and rapid recovery of damages (including damage to numerous infrastructures and the healthcare system, various social issues related to displaced persons from Artsakh, as well as the looming pandemic, etc.). It was important to gather not only financial resources but also human resources to organize these works as quickly as possible.

In this context, the Board of Trustees of the Armenia Pan-Armenian Foundation decided to provide specific assistance to the budget of the Republic of Armenia within the framework of the fundraising "We Are Our Borders" for the purpose of unifying the implementation process of such expenses (social, health, infrastructure, etc.). The Board of Trustees has made appropriate decisions based on which the assistance provided by the Foundation has the corresponding substantiated documentation.

The funds have been directed towards the needs of tens of thousands of compatriots displaced from Artsakh, as well as for the financing of healthcare, social, infrastructure, and other critical sectors. According to the charter of the Armenia Pan-Armenian Foundation, the executive board is preparing a detailed report on its activities and expenditures, which will be reviewed by the Foundation’s Audit Commission and presented for approval to the Board of Trustees.

The financial statements of the Foundation will be published after an audit study, along with the conclusion of an independent auditor of international renown. Staying true to our motto of spending donors' resources economically, efficiently, and purposefully, the remaining funds will also be allocated to meet the various needs of families of those displaced from Artsakh, the families of the deceased and wounded, as well as families returning to Artsakh (utility expenses, reconstruction works, partial compensation for lost property, benefits, etc.), which is currently a top priority. Detailed programs are already being developed in this direction with partner organizations.

As an apolitical charitable organization pursuing charitable, social, economic, scientific, educational, cultural, healthcare, and other public benefit objectives, the Foundation will continue to operate in accordance with its missions and statutory goals for the benefit of Armenia, Artsakh, and the Diaspora.
